#68abd5 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#68abd5 is composed of 40.8% red, 67.1% green and 83.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 51.2% cyan, 19.7% magenta, 0% yellow and 16.5% black. It has a hue angle of 203.1 degrees, a saturation of 56.5% and a lightness of 62.2%. #68abd5 color hex could be obtained by blending #d0ffff with #0057ab. Closest websafe color is: #6699cc.

Shades and Tints of #68abd5
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#010202 is the darkest color, while #f2f8fb is the lightest one.

Tones of #68abd5
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#9c9fa1 is the less saturated color, while #43b4fa is the most saturated one.
